zoukankan      html  css  js  c++  java
  • CTreeCtrl控件

    一、HTREEITEM

    HTREEITEM是树中节点的句柄,也就是一个DWORD值。在树中唯一标识一个节点。它的值对于程序员其实没有什么意义,只是可以通过它找到一个节点,从而取得节点的属性,如
    GetItemText( HTREEITEM hItem ) ;或对节点进行某些操作,如删除DeleteItem( HTREEITEM hItem );

    二、插入新节点

    每棵树必定有一个根节点hRoot,其它的子节点都是在这棵树下不断插入进去的,到底怎么确定插入哪一棵节点下面呢?

    InsertItem参数告诉了你:

    HTREEITEM hItem=InsertItem(itemName,int nImage,int nSelectedImage,hParent,hInsertAfter)

    该函数返回该节点的句柄,参数2代表插入图片的位置,参数3是节点被选中后应该显示的图片的位置,参数4即代表该节点的父节点,参数5代表要插在谁的后面,默认值为最后的节点。

    三、为每个节点关联一个值

    SetItemData(hItem,DWORD_PTR dwData)

    dwData是一个unsigned long型的数据类型,通常这个参数传递的是一个数据类型的指针,一定要进行转化。

    DWORD_PTR dwData=GetItemData(hItem)

    获取关联的值

  • 相关阅读:
    samba服务器之无认证进入共享目录
    中断
    html里<div> <br /> <p>三者区别
    块级元素和内联元素
    div和span标签
    django添加装饰器
    cookie和session
    Django报错:__init__() missing 1 required positional argument: 'on_delete'
    pycharm创建新django app
    djiango控制语句
  • 原文地址:https://www.cnblogs.com/zhuluqing/p/9067276.html
Copyright © 2011-2022 走看看